技术文摘
学习数据存储技巧,掌握sessionstorage使用方法
学习数据存储技巧,掌握sessionstorage使用方法
在当今数字化时代,数据存储对于网页应用的重要性不言而喻。其中,sessionstorage作为一种常用的前端数据存储方式,有着独特的优势和广泛的应用场景。掌握它的使用方法,能为我们的开发工作带来极大便利。
Sessionstorage是HTML5提供的一种本地存储机制,用于在浏览器会话期间存储数据。与传统的cookie相比,它具有更大的存储空间,能够存储更多类型的数据,且数据不会随着HTTP请求发送到服务器,提高了性能和安全性。
要使用sessionstorage,首先需要了解其基本的操作方法。存储数据时,可以使用setItem()方法,该方法接受两个参数,第一个参数是键名,第二个参数是对应的值。例如:sessionStorage.setItem('username', 'John'); 这样就将用户名'John'存储到了sessionstorage中。
获取数据则使用getItem()方法,传入键名即可获取对应的值。如:var username = sessionStorage.getItem('username'); 若要删除某个特定的数据,可以使用removeItem()方法,传入要删除数据的键名。而清除所有sessionstorage中的数据,则使用clear()方法。
Sessionstorage的应用场景非常丰富。比如,在电商网站中,用户在浏览商品时,我们可以使用sessionstorage存储用户的浏览历史,当用户再次访问时,能够根据其历史记录提供个性化的推荐。又或者在表单填写页面,当用户不小心刷新页面时,通过sessionstorage可以保存用户已填写的部分信息,避免用户重新输入。
然而,需要注意的是,sessionstorage的数据只在当前会话期间有效。一旦用户关闭浏览器窗口或标签页,数据就会被清除。在使用时要根据具体需求合理选择存储方式。
学习数据存储技巧,尤其是掌握sessionstorage的使用方法,对于前端开发人员来说至关重要。它不仅能提升用户体验,还能优化网页应用的性能。在实际开发中,我们应充分发挥sessionstorage的优势,为用户打造更加高效、便捷的网页应用。
- HarmonyOS 编程页面跳转(Java 注释版)
- 单片机中若干 C 语言算法的应用
- Java 必备工具库,大幅削减 90%代码量
- Webpack:从零教你编写 loader 与 plugin
- Facebook 推出 VR 广告致 Oculus 软件开发商撤离
- 迭代器模式:设计模式系列
- 从零开始用 Electron 搭建桌面端 Dooring
- ASP.NET Core MVC 中 Razor 视图引擎的使用方法
- 100 万并发秒杀系统架构
- TypeScript 中 interface 与 type 的常见困惑:区别在哪?
- 微服务架构中的系统集成
- 哈啰在分布式消息与微服务治理中的 RocketMQ 实践之路
- Python 3.10 的新特性有哪些?
- 华为开发者刷 KPI 事件 当事人作出回应
- 借助此开源项目 不懂 Web 开发也能使数据“动”起来